This week we’re taking it back to ‘Lean Back’ – the sole #1 hit single from Terror Squad (led by Fat Joe & Remy Ma).  The second single from the group’s album, ‘True Story,’ ‘Lean’ was launched to radio early June 2004 and, just 8 weeks later, found itself perched atop the Hot 100 (where it was found this week that year). Knocking another of the year’s hip-hop anthems, rapper Juvenile‘s comeback single ‘Slow Motion,’ out of the top spot, ‘Lean’ eventually worked its way to Gold status.

Going on to become one of the ten most successful songs of the year, the bop’s topping of the charts was also unique in that a) every song in the top 10 that week in 2004 was by an artist of color and b) every act that topped the Hot 100 that year was a person (or people) of color.  Sigh…good times.
